Damaged Glass

Broken glass is one of the most common issues that double-paned windows have to face. This is typically caused by a problem with the window seal which allows water-laden air to enter between the glass panes. This could cause the window to look foggy or swollen, and can also degrade the insulating value of the window.

It is possible to fix some cracks in a double-paned window. However, you must seek out a professional right away when they begin to appear. The crack could cause the entire window to break, causing significant damage and leaks of water. In some cases an expert can carry out a temporary repair by placing adhesive in the cracks in order to prevent them from becoming worse.

If a double-pane windows is completely broken, it cannot be repaired and will need to be replaced. If the frame is intact but the glass is cracked, it could be possible to repair the pane. This is a cheaper option than replacing the entire window, and it could be done in a shorter time.

In addition to repairing damaged glass, a double-pane specialist can also repair the frame and sash. This kind repair is hard to perform on your own and requires the use of special tools. It is important to hire an expert to repair a double-paned window.

A window repair specialist can also carry out a thermal seal and repair of the sash cord on windows with double panes. Repairs like these can restore the insulating properties of the window, and also save homeowners money on energy costs.

Double-paned windows also suffer from blown windows that can be costly to repair. If the window seal is damaged, it allows moisture-laden air to pass through the two panes and cause the window to become cloudy or wet. This can be caused by a damaged pane or a broken window seal.

A double-pane expert in window repair can replace the blown window pane and restore the insulating properties of the window. The cost of window repair depends on the size and type of window.

Leakage of Argon Gas

Argon gas that is colorless, odorless and non-toxic has recently gained a lot of attention in window glass that are energy efficient. It is an effective insulation and helps keep the heat out during summer, while reducing drafts in winter. It also prevents the buildup of condensation between window panes that can lead to ugly cloudy appearance. Argon gas is a viable alternative to air for double pane windows that are environmentally safe.

While argon gas is effective in reducing the cost of energy, it's not impervious to destruction. In certain cases the seals may fail and leak gas from your windows. A professional window repair service can replace missing argon gas without replacing the entire window unit.

A window technician can assist you to determine if your windows are equipped with gas argon by looking at the window label and specifications or searching for two tiny holes in the spacer bar that are designed to allow both air and argon to escape. You may also search for a capillary tube that allows the argon gas to be absorbed into your home from higher altitudes.

Most windows have a gap between the two panes. The gap between the two panes is filled with a viscous liquid that moves slowly, such as argon. This improves the insulation properties of the window. The gas fill also reduces convective currents inside the glass and reduces the transfer of heat between the glass panes.

If the argon in your window fails, water could condense between the panes. This causes the annoying cloudy appearance that is a telltale indication of window failure. It is crucial to identify the problem early in order to avoid more costly repairs.

With an air pressure gauge, a window expert can determine the amount of argon gas within your double pane windows and measure the amount that has escaped out over time. If you've lost a significant amount of gas, it may be time to replace your IGU. A window specialist can inject argon into the gaps between window panes by using a special instrument.

Condensation

In addition to the aesthetics issues of cloudiness and water staining condensation in double pane windows double glazing is an issue for home energy efficiency. As moisture enters the air pocket that separates the two panes of glass, it becomes less insulative. This results in your cooling and heating systems to work extra hard to keep your room at a comfortable temperature. This can result in costly window replacements in the long term.

If your windows are exhibiting signs of condensation, you should immediately contact window specialists to inspect the situation and make repairs. They can determine if the windows are able to be salvaged or if they require replacement. It is possible to replace only the glass unit within the window frame that is already in place that is known as an gas insulated unit (IGU). To do so, you will need to take the sash off by dislodging it from the corner screws that hold it in place. Then, you'll have to locate the screws that join the frame to the sash and remove those. After you have removed the sash, it should be easy to pull out of the frame and pull off the gasket that is in the window.

After the IGU is removed After the IGU has been removed, a professional can assess the condition of your glass and replace it with a new seal. This is usually a fairly cost-effective and quick procedure. It is important to note however that if the seals are broken or compromised in any way that can't be repaired, it's recommended to consider a complete replacement window.

Certain companies offer defogging options for Double glzing-paned windows. However, this is only an interim solution that will not restore the sealed spaces. The inside moisture will still enter the air pocket and cause fogging, and eventually, the minerals in the moisture will scratch the glass. This can make your windows look unattractive and reduce their energy efficiency. It is recommended that you seek out a professional window installer to determine what your options are for replacing your double-pane windows.

Drafts

The drafty windows can result in huge energy bills. While draught proofing can be an effective temporary solution, it's best to invest in replacement windows that are energy efficient and properly installed.

A common cause of window drafts is that the seal between triple or double pane windows has failed. When this happens, the argon gas that keeps the windows energy efficient is released. This could make the air inside your home feel cold and reduce the comfort.

Cracks or gaps in the frame of the window can also create drafts. These are usually caused by age, wear and tear, or temperature fluctuations. If the problem is not dealt with immediately, it could cause water infiltration or wall damage and drafty sensations to the home.

A gap in the frame can be fixed easily by caulking or stripping. It is possible to do this yourself If you follow the directions and are careful. However, if you're unsure sure of the best way to go about this or don't have the time, then you should seek professional assistance.

If your windows are old or not installed by a reputable company, it's likely that there are weak spots in the seals around them. This could cause condensation, draughts or even mist between the panes.
